Christina Lindley’s Diet:
* 1st meal:
3 Egg White Omelet with spinach, mushrooms, and onions with oatmeal
OR
Hi/Lo Protein Cereal
with raspberries and soy milk
* 2nd meal:
Protein bar
* 3rd meal:
Lean turkey patty with spinach salad
* 4th meal:
Chicken and some kind of green veggie
* Snacks:
Almonds, and berries, or a protein bar
Christina Lindley’s Training Routine:
* Circuit training for an hour 3 times a week, pilates, and yoga atleast once a week, cardio training usually elliptical or treadmill on an incline for 45 minutes to an hour 4-6 times a week.
